Really? 99% of the Hamptons and HGIs I stay in don't have a "best room." They have a bunch of rooms that are all identical.

I do pretty well with upgrades at full service Hilton and DoubleTree properties, although usually I have my MyWay preference set to the points, not the upgrade/breakfast. If I'm traveling for work, by myself, the upgrade to a larger room/suite usually isn't all that enjoyable, and the points come in handy for vacations. And I can always expense breakfast to work. However, about 80% of the time I get the points, and they still bump me to the executive floor and a nicer room, so it's the best of both worlds.

At Hamptons, the 250 points are worth more to me than a bottle of water and package of cookies. And at HGIs, it's rare I don't get the breakfast coupons even when I'm set to get the 750 points as my amenity.
